openldap专题

使用docker compose一键部署 Openldap

使用docker compose一键部署 Openldap LDAP(轻量级目录访问协议,Lightweight Directory Access Protocol)是一种用于访问分布式目录服务的网络协议,OpenLDAP 是 LDAP 协议的一个开源实现,由 OpenLDAP 项目提供,常用于管理企业内的用户、计算机、网络等资源。 1、创建安装目录 mkdir /data/openldap

如何使用 STARTTLS 加密 OpenLDAP 连接

简介 OpenLDAP提供了一个灵活且得到良好支持的LDAP目录服务。然而,默认情况下,服务器本身是通过未加密的网络连接进行通信的。在本指南中,我们将演示如何使用STARTTLS加密连接到OpenLDAP,以将传统连接升级为TLS。我们将使用Ubuntu 14.04作为我们的LDAP服务器。 先决条件 在开始本指南之前,您应该在服务器上设置一个具有sudo权限的非root用户。要设置此类型的

【DevOps工具篇】 OpenLDAP的LDAP服务器(slapd)是什么?

目录 OpenLAP的LDAP服务器(slapd)是什么基本功能安全性管理性可靠性和可扩展性调优 OpenLDAP的服务器基本功能简单身份验证和SASL身份验证LDAP模式 OpenLDAP服务器管理LDAP服务器配置LDAP数据备份和还原slapcatslapaddslapindex

Openldap忘记修改密码

原创作品,允许转载,转载时请务必以超链接形式标明文章 原始出处 、作者信息和本声明。否则将追究法律责任。http://jerry12356.blog.51cto.com/4308715/1857969 生产环境中,可能有各种各样的原因,导致openldap的管理账号密码丢失,可能ldap服务和用户都能正常工作或使用,但是由于openldap是底层的用户信息存储目录,如果环境中的众多服务(如

openldap 备份与导入 及相关问题

摘要:   对openldap进行备份时,直接使用slapcat命令进行备份,使用ldapadd还原出现问题及解决。 介绍:   对openldap进行备份时,直接使用slapcat命令进行备份(如代码一),然后使用ldapadd还原会出现以下报错信息:   ldap_add: Constraint violation (10)   additional info: structural

Centos7 下Yum安装OpenLdap

环境: Centos7 OpenLdap 2.4.44 openldap新版本和老版本的配置方法差别特别大 安装步骤 1.yum安装OpenLdap # yum -y install openldap compat-openldap openldap-clients openldap-servers openldap-servers-sql openldap-devel migrat

centos 7.6 安装 openldap 2.5.17

centos 7.6 安装ldap 1、下载ldap2、安装ldap2.1、官方参考文档2.2、安装前准备2.2.1、安装gcc2.2.2、安装Cyrus SASL 2.1.27+2.2.3、安装OpenSSL 1.1.1+2.2.3.1、下载openssl 3.02.2.3.2、安装依赖包2.2.3.3、编译安装openssl 3.0 2.2.3、安装libevent 2.1.8+2.2.

RHEL6.3之OpenLDAP配置实践

OpenLDAP服务器建设比较麻烦,一不注意就会出错,本人经过数十次尝试,总算搭起来了,现分享给大家,也方便自己日后回过头来看看。   I、OpenLDAP的安装与基本配置 1  Yum安装 yum -y install openldap-servers openldap-clients 2  vi /etc/sysconfig/ldap,确保SLAPD_LDAPI=yes 3  创建

Gitlab集成openLDAP统一认证登录

vim /etc/gitlab/gitlab.rb, 可以配置很多个server,因此与sssd服务一样可以配置多个ldap作为高可用 gitlab-ctl reconfiguregitlab-rake gitlab:ldap:checkgitlab-ctl restart gitlab-rake gitlab:ldap:checkChecking LDAP ...LDAP: ... S

OpenLDAP使用疑惑解答及使用Java完成LDAP身份认证

导读 LDAP(轻量级目录访问协议,Lightweight Directory Access Protocol)是实现提供被称为目录服务的信息服务。目录服务是一种特殊的数据库系统,其专门针对读取,浏览和搜索操作进行了特定的优化。目录一般用来包含描述性的,基于属性的信息并支持精细复杂的过滤能力。目录一般不支持通用数据库针对大量更新操作操作需要的复杂的事务管理或回卷策略。而目录服务的更新则一般都非常

docker-compaose部署openldap

前段时间在本地搭建了一套gitlab geo测试环境,因为需要集成ldap,所以特意搭建下,特此作为笔记记录下。 文章目录 1. 前置条件2. 编写docker-openldap.yml文件3. 登录4. 使用创建组创建用户登录测试 1. 前置条件 安装docker-compose 安装docker 创建挂载目录 2. 编写docker-openldap.yml文件

docker-compaose部署openldap

前段时间在本地搭建了一套gitlab geo测试环境,因为需要集成ldap,所以特意搭建下,特此作为笔记记录下。 文章目录 1. 前置条件2. 编写docker-openldap.yml文件3. 登录4. 使用创建组创建用户登录测试 1. 前置条件 安装docker-compose 安装docker 创建挂载目录 2. 编写docker-openldap.yml文件

openldap安装部署

1. LDAP概述 1.1. LDAP基本概念 LDAP的目的是为各种软件提供统一标准的认证机制,所有软件就可以不再用独有的用户管理方法,而是通过这种统一的认证机制进行用户认证。 1.2. LDAP的主要应用场景 网络服务:DNS服务统一认证服务Linux PAM(ssh,login, cvs…)Apache访问控制各种服务登录(ftpd, php based, perl based, pyth

将 OpenLDAP 与 IBM Spectrum LSF 集成

IBM Spectrum LSF 是一个工作负载管理平台,提供强大的资源管理功能来优化应用程序性能和最大限度提高资源使用率。 OpenLDAP 是轻量级目录访问协议 (LDAP) 的开放式源代码实现,提供集中式认证和目录服务。 通过遵循本教程中概述的步骤,您可以将 OpenLDAP 与 IBM Spectrum LSF集成,这使您能够使用现有 LDAP 基础结构进行认证,从而使用户能够更安全,更

Ranger2.4+OpenLdap 用户权限管理

介绍 使用openldap做统一用户管理 使用ranger做用户权限管理 对Hdfs,Hive,Spark,Trino,Yarn进行权限控制 openLdap用户 执行以下命令,添加用户,用户组 组用户用户用户shuguoliubeiguanyuzhangfeiweiguocaocaocaopicaozhiwuguoshunquanshuncelvmeng user='zhangfei'

Hdoop学习笔记(HDP)-Part.09 安装OpenLDAP

目录 Part.01 关于HDP Part.02 核心组件原理 Part.03 资源规划 Part.04 基础环境配置 Part.05 Yum源配置 Part.06 安装OracleJDK Part.07 安装MySQL Part.08 部署Ambari集群 Part.09 安装OpenLDAP Part.10 创建集群 Part.11 安装Kerberos Part.12 安装HDFS Part

ECS Linux搭建OpenLDAP服务

背景 想搭建一个LDAP的服务,作为测试用。于是在阿里云上买了台测试机。搭建。 参考了这位大神的文章《OpenLDAP(2.4.3x)服务器搭建及配置说明》,基本上按照他的步骤做了搭建,我针对自己遇到的问题做了一下备注。 如果只是为了看一下ldap怎么用,完全不用这么麻烦。 下载Apache Directory Studio,直接在里面可以开启ApacheDS服务,就可以做基础的了解了。 正文

LDAP落地实战(一):OpenLDAP部署及管理维护

非常棒的一篇文章: LDAP落地实战(一):OpenLDAP部署及管理维护 相关延伸文章: LDAP落地实战(二):SVN集成OpenLDAP认证LDAP落地实战(三):GitLab集成OpenLDAP认证LDAP落地实战(四):Jenkins集成OpenLDAP认证

(三)Harbor使用OpenLDAP认证登陆

接上一篇《安装Harbor》,安装好之后,接下来我们使用OpenLDAP来进行Harbor  web界面的登陆验证及权限分配! OpenLDAP:   使用OpenLDAP的都知道,这是一个集中的用户账号管理系统;使用轻量级目录访问协议(LDAP)构建集中的身份验证系统可以减少管理成本,增强安全性,避免数据复制的问题,并提高数据的一致性。 随着服务器的增加,随着用户权限的复杂性增加,只有几台服

centos 6.5 openldap php,Centos7.6 openldap部署

Centos7.6 openldap部署 花了一个星期左右研究。 一、安装环境 二、安装openldap并启动slapd.service服务 三、copy DB_CONFIG.example 并授权DB_CONFIG目录权限 四、设定slapd编译过的密码并保存,修改文件中要用到。 五、新增vim chrootpw.ldif及vim chdomain.ldif&vim basedomain.ld

Openldap用户组创建

Openldap 部署过程可以看请看我之前的博客,openldap + phpldapadmin + nginx 搭建部署教程(完整版)_rockstics的博客-CSDN博客_ldap服务器搭建nginx 在phpldapadmin web页面创建用户组,不用编写复杂的ldif文件 1.首先创建用户,可以用ldif导入,也可以直接在页面创建, 在OU=people中点击“创建新条目” -->

如何创建OpenLDAP成员组

原文连接:https://kifarunix.com/how-to-create-openldap-member-groups/ How to Create OpenLDAP Member Groups By koromicha -November 15, 201904213 While assigning specific access rights or permissions to user

Openldap 添加日志和禁止匿名用户登录

加载日志模块: 2.4.4 版本系统默认有 cat > /root/loglevel.ldif << “EOF”dn: cn=configchangetype: modifyreplace: olcLogLevelolcLogLevel: statsEOFldapmodify -Y EXTERNAL -H ldapi:/// -f /root/loglevel.ldifsystemct